/* Generated from page: safetygroups */
.themify_builder_content-9289 .tb_sdji432>.builder_row_cover::before{background-color:rgba(0, 0, 0, .35)}
.themify_builder_content-9289 .tb_sdji432{background-position:50% 50%;background-attachment:scroll;background-size:cover;background-repeat:no-repeat;background-image:url(../0623_CPS_Header_TexasMutual_1.jpg)}
.themify_builder_content-9289 .tb_4e2l503>.row_inner,.themify_builder_content-9289 .tb_y85k280>.row_inner{--align_content:var(--align_center);--colg:var(--none)}
.themify_builder_content-9289 .tb_4opz503{background-position:100% 50%;background-attachment:scroll;background-size:cover;background-repeat:no-repeat;background-image:url(../AgentsWin_CPS.jpg)}
.themify_builder_content-9289 .tb_h8hb503,.themify_builder_content-9289 .tb_v50e280{padding:12%;background-color:#212144}
.themify_builder_content-9289 .tb_l9qz115.module-feature .module-feature-icon,.themify_builder_content-9289 .tb_gz1q548.module-feature .module-feature-icon,.themify_builder_content-9289 .tb_a3zj381.module-feature .module-feature-icon,.themify_builder_content-9289 .tb_336j577.module-feature .module-feature-icon{font-size:1.7em}
.themify_builder_content-9289 .tb_6tpa238,.themify_builder_content-9289 .tb_fq1g239{background-color:#fff}
.themify_builder_content-9289 .tb_5i84191,.themify_builder_content-9289 .tb_j3a7512{padding-right:10%;padding-left:10%}
.themify_builder_content-9289 .tb_blk6191,.themify_builder_content-9289 .tb_3dle301,.themify_builder_content-9289 .tb_g6jj302,.themify_builder_content-9289 .tb_qq0m512,.themify_builder_content-9289 .tb_x21l513,.themify_builder_content-9289 .tb_e7kf513{padding-right:3%;padding-left:3%}
.themify_builder_content-9289 .tb_u17q682.module-image,.themify_builder_content-9289 .tb_tws7857.module-image,.themify_builder_content-9289 .tb_8h94959.module-image,.themify_builder_content-9289 .tb_a3e7513.module-image,.themify_builder_content-9289 .tb_90li513.module-image,.themify_builder_content-9289 .tb_urze514.module-image{padding-bottom:15px}
.themify_builder_content-9289 .tb_x331419{background-color:#f5f5f5}
.themify_builder_content-9289 .tb_38pe311.module-text,.themify_builder_content-9289 .tb_ia9w5.module-text,.themify_builder_content-9289 .tb_tlza930.module-text,.themify_builder_content-9289 .tb_qdcp735.module-text{padding-bottom:20px}
.themify_builder_content-9289 .tb_38pe311.module-text.module h2,.themify_builder_content-9289 .tb_2gbw479.module-text.module h2,.themify_builder_content-9289 .tb_how3964.module-text.module h2,.themify_builder_content-9289 .tb_udbv389.module-text.module h2,.themify_builder_content-9289 .tb_r932421.module-text.module h2{font-size:3em;line-height:1.3em}
.themify_builder_content-9289 .tb_38pe311.module-text.module h3,.themify_builder_content-9289 .tb_2gbw479.module-text.module h3,.themify_builder_content-9289 .tb_how3964.module-text.module h3,.themify_builder_content-9289 .tb_udbv389.module-text.module h3,.themify_builder_content-9289 .tb_r932421.module-text.module h3{font-size:1.5em}
.themify_builder_content-9289 .tb_fee9725.module-buttons,.themify_builder_content-9289 .tb_7v9l810.module-buttons,.themify_builder_content-9289 .tb_hhvu539.module-buttons,.themify_builder_content-9289 .tb_tgo8784.module-buttons,.themify_builder_content-9289 .tb_knaa697.module-buttons{text-align:center}
.themify_builder_content-9289 .tb_n6bf971.module-buttons{text-align:left}
.themify_builder_content-9289 .tb_gv4d280{background-position:50% 0%;background-attachment:scroll;background-size:cover;background-repeat:no-repeat;background-image:url(../Nonprofit_CPS.jpg)}

@media(max-width:1024px){
.themify_builder_content-9289 .tb_4opz503{background-position:50% 0%}
.themify_builder_content-9289 .tb_h8hb503,.themify_builder_content-9289 .tb_v50e280{padding:6%}
.themify_builder_content-9289 .tb_fq1g239{background-color:#f5f5f5}
.themify_builder_content-9289 .tb_y85k280>.row_inner{--area:"col2 col1"}
.themify_builder_content-9289 .tb_gv4d280{background-position:0% 0%}
}
@media(max-width:768px){
.themify_builder_content-9289 .tb_4e2l503>.row_inner,.themify_builder_content-9289 .tb_y85k280>.row_inner{--area:"col1" "col2"}
.themify_builder_content-9289 .tb_4opz503{padding:20%}
.themify_builder_content-9289 .tb_gv4d280{padding:20%;background-position:50% 0%}
}
@media(max-width:600px){
.themify_builder_content-9289 .tb_4e2l503>.row_inner,.themify_builder_content-9289 .tb_i73t420,.themify_builder_content-9289 .tb_y85k280>.row_inner{--area:var(--aream2_auto)}
.themify_builder_content-9289 .tb_5i84191,.themify_builder_content-9289 .tb_j3a7512,.themify_builder_content-9289 .tb_kd05296{--area:var(--aream3_auto)}
}